Australia has decided to ban TikTok on government devices, joining a growing list of Western nations cracking down on the Chinese-owned app due to national security fears. Attorney-General Mark Dreyfus said on Tuesday the decision followed advice from the country’s intelligence agencies and would begin “as soon as practicable”.
